ssd: add ssd_interactive_box()
...which is used by desktop_view_at() and ssd_at() to determine which decoration part is under the cursor. ssd_interactive_box() allows deocoration parts to extend outside the visible regions, and therefore supports a wider 'resize-edges' area than the border itself.
